基于正交小波变换的自适应语音消噪改进方法

An Improved Method for Adaptive Speech Denoising Based on Orthogonal Wavelet Transform

  • 摘要: 提出一种基于正交小波变换的自适应语音消噪改进方法,这种方法可以提高自适应语音消噪过程的收敛速率.正交小波变换在自适应滤波中起到白化的作用,使自适应滤波器的输入正交化.通过正交小波分解,自适应滤波器中的信号能量降低,输入自相关矩阵的动态范围减小,特征值分布更加集中,从而使收敛速率加快.

     

    Abstract: An improved method based on orthogonal wavelet transform for adaptive speech denoising is proposed,which can increase the convergence rate of the adaptive speech denoising process.Orthogonal wavelet transform plays a part in whiting,and enables the adaptive filter input signals to be orthogonal.With orthogonal wavelet analysis,the energy in the adaptive filter of every wavelet subspace is lowered,the dynamic domain of the input auto-correlated matrix of the adaptive filter is reduced,and the distribution of eigenvalues is more concentrated,so the convergence rate is increased.
